About Xuemei Li

Xuemei Li is a scholar working on Management Science and Operations Research, Ecological Modeling and Economics and Econometrics, having authored 265 papers that have together received 5.3k indexed citations. Recurring topics across this work include Grey System Theory Applications (41 papers), Energy, Environment, Economic Growth (21 papers) and Energy Load and Power Forecasting (16 papers). The work is most often cited by research in Management Science and Operations Research (484 citations), Pollution (402 citations) and Radiological and Ultrasound Technology (176 citations). Xuemei Li has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Fengqing Jiang, Wanlin Guo, Lanhai Li, Binggan Wei, Kedong Yin, Shuyong Mu, Jianxin Zhou, Jun Yin, Yaoguo Dang and Yan Li. Their work appears in journals such as Nature, Nature Communications and SHILAP Revista de lepidopterología.
